Buses from New York to New Haven (Academy/Gobuses)

New Haven is a city located along the coast in the US state of Connecticut. There are several transit systems connecting these two cities, but buses provide a quick, comfortable, and convenient way to travel from New York to New Haven. Go Buses is the major bus company that plies this route. Go Buses offer at least one trip from New York to New Haven daily. The average distance from New York to New Haven is approximately 70 miles (112 kilometers). A direct bus from New York to New Haven takes about one hour and 50 minutes to complete its journey. An indirect service between the two destinations regularly takes more than two hours and 30 minutes. Stamford, CT, is the halfway point from New York to New Haven.

How long is the bus ride from New York to New Haven?

The average distance between New York and New Haven is 70 miles (112 kilometers). The duration of time taken to travel from New York to New Haven varies depending on whether the bus trip is direct or has a stopover, and the length of the stopover. The average bus between New York and New Haven takes around two hours and 30 minutes, whereas the quickest Go Buses journey will take you to New Haven in one hour and 50 minutes. The stopovers, if any, take about 30 minutes and can increase the overall journey duration considerably. Travelers can find discounted deals by booking bus tickets from New York to New Haven earlier as ticket price increase as the departure date approaches.

What are the departure and arrival stations for buses from New York to New Haven?

Departure bus station: bus services from New York to New Haven depart from several bus stations. The major bus station for Go Buses from New York to New Haven is W 30th St, between 9th and 10th Ave, and the Port Authority Bus Station. Port Authority station serves as the primary entry point for regional buses and is run by the Port Authority of New York and New Jersey. It is located in midtown between 40th street and 42nd street near the west block of Times Square, and east block of the Lincoln Tunnel. For traveler's convenience, information booths, ticket plazas, waiting areas, restrooms, ATMs, shops, and restaurants are provided at the Port Authority Bus Station.

Arrival bus station: the arrival stations for Go Buses services in New Haven is the Union Station or Union Station Parking Garage. Union Station is the main railroad travelers' station in New Haven and is located at Meadow Street's foot near the Union Station Parking Garage. This is about 0.9 miles from New Haven city center, a walkable distance of about 20 minutes. The station serves as the departure point for more than 500 daily trips from New Haven to various locations, including New York, Baltimore, and Boston. Some of the facilities provided by both the bus stations include dining options, coffee shops, bars, payphones, elevators, restrooms, and free WiFi. Taxi dispatch services are available at the station for the convenience of travelers with lots of luggage and also convenient parking facilities.
